Nutulator Posted June 16, 2017 Share Posted June 16, 2017 Keywords. With linings its Mod Association keywords, Object Mods are attached to these keywords and it's these Object Mods which apply effects like radiation resistance. Not sure about colors, but it might be it's using the color patellae texture in some OMs since I see in the material OMs "fColorRemappingIndex."
